Wale Adeniyi becomes substantive Comptroller-General of Customs
President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has confirmed the appointment of Adewale Adeniyi as substantive Comptroller-General of the Nigeria Customs Service.
His appointment is contained in a statement obtained on Friday from the Secretary to the Government of the Federation, George Akume, adding that it took effect from October 19, 2023.
Adeniyi was named acting CG of Customs by the President in June this year.
The statement signed by the Director, Information in the SGF office, Willie Bassey, said Adeniyi’s appointment was in accordance with the extant provisions of the Public Service Rules (PSR).
The President urged the CGC to bring his wealth of experience to bear on his new assignment.
